Abstract
In this paper, we introduce a singular fractional-order Hamiltonian system with several spectral parameters. Using the inertia indices of the corresponding Hermitian forms we provide a lower bound for the number of linearly independent integrable-square solutions. Moreover, we introduce the Titchmarsh-Weyl function together with an intermediate theorem on the number of the integrable-square solutions. At the end of the paper, we show that 2-sequential and 4-sequential scalar fractional-order differential equations can be embedded into such Hamiltonian systems.
